Output 081c55b74b8324a9511d3ccf650901b7105858062192f2985324334bb43128d6:6

value
15840789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ad74a743b229af2f9edb6254ac6a73b4ab8dcf09 OP_EQUAL
address
3HWAZx17AQtrjmbLMRATTAvvg2xcuJ3zqN
transaction
081c55b74b8324a9511d3ccf650901b7105858062192f2985324334bb43128d6
spent
true